
【电】 first selector
【法】 first division
selector
【计】 selector
【医】 selector
在汉英词典视角下,“第一级选择器”(First-Level Selector)是CSS(层叠样式表)中的一个核心概念,特指在文档树中直接匹配父元素下的子元素的选择器。其核心含义与功能如下:
层级关系
指选择器仅作用于父元素的直接子元素(仅下一层级),而非所有后代元素。其语法使用>
符号连接父级与子级选择器(如 ul > li
)。
汉英对照:
精准定位
与后代选择器(空格分隔)不同,第一级选择器避免深层嵌套元素的干扰,精准控制样式作用范围。例如:
/* 仅匹配ul下的直接li子元素 */
ul > li { color: red; }
.class
)同级,优先级值为 0,1,0
(高于元素选择器)。定义:“第一级选择器通过 >
符号指定父元素的直接子元素,实现样式精确继承。”
明确区分 Parent > Child
与 Parent Child
的语义差异,强调 >
的“直接子代”特性。
<ul class="menu">
<li>一级菜单
<ul>
<li>二级菜单</li> <!-- 不受 ul > li 影响 -->
</ul>
</li>
</ul>
.menu > li {
font-weight: bold; /* 仅一级菜单加粗 */
}
“第一级选择器”并非CSS或前端开发中的标准术语,可能是以下两种常见场景的误用或特定语境下的表述:
若指CSS Level 1(1996年发布)中定义的选择器,则包括:
p
、div
,通过标签名匹配元素。.classname
,通过class
属性匹配。#idname
,通过id
属性精准匹配单个元素。div span
),选择嵌套的后代元素。a:link
、a:visited
,用于未访问/已访问的超链接。若指结构层级中的第一级子元素,则对应子组合器 >
,例如:
ul > li {
color: red; /* 仅选择直接子级<li>,不匹配嵌套更深层的<li> */
}
style="..."
)优先级最高。如需进一步解答,请提供更多上下文或核实术语来源。
苯烯丙基布绑腿不合格产品批量容许百分比不容剥夺的权利蠢驴大麦芽硷丁酸丁酯锇处理二因子杂合体法律的规范性妃肺底外侧段支气管过度饱和鼾性罗音胶体性甲状腺肿快速试验法临界水头葡糖缩氯醛三油精伤寒菌残质烧鸡设备容差声光感觉的双重分集运用思想变化过速速食的调谐簧频率计停泊灯威尔逊氏苔癣